5 smart hacks to store foods in your refrigerator

The refrigerator has proven to be a boon in our lives. Although it has been a part of every household for quite some time now, many people still struggle to keep their food fresh, and their refrigerator organized. Food can go stale or lose its freshness and taste if it is not kept properly in the fridge. Also, if you wish to not run out of space in your refrigerator, you need to organize it properly.

Here are some hacks that will help you to achieve both of these goals.

Set the right temperature
The most important thing to look after is the temperature of the refrigerator and the freezer. The refrigerator’s temperature should be below forty degrees Fahrenheit, and the freezer’s temperature should be below zero degrees Fahrenheit so that you can keep food fresh for long with freezers.

Use baskets
You can take the help of baskets to keep your refrigerator organized. A different basket for each type of food. For example, dairy products go into one basket while fruits in another one.

Choose the container wisely
The freshness of the food depends a lot on the type of container it has been stored in. Glass containers are safer and eco-friendly. They also have the advantage of being see through. While using plastic containers, be sure to check the quality of the plastic used to make it. Only good quality plastic containers can help you keep food fresh for long with freezers.

Store fruits and vegetables separately
It is better to store fruits and vegetables separately in the refrigerator. Almost every fridge has a separate place for storing the vegetables which come with moisture and temperature control. Avoid storing fruits such as banana, avocado, and figs in the refrigerator. For other fruits, avoid storing them in airtight bags or containers.

Airtight packaging is a must
While storing food in the freezer, be sure that you put them into airtight bags or containers. It will help you to keep food fresh for long with freezers. In case of raw meat, wrap it up in freezer paper.

Follow these tips to keep the freshness of your food intact, and your refrigerator organized like a pro.
